go on ebay and search for the LT and ALT models. The 125 and 185 are basicly the same. I found a guy in MI parting out 125 and he cut me a deal on shipping. I picked up a skidplate, footpegs, headlight, tank cover w/odometer, and few other odds and ends for 50 bucks and 12 bucks in shipping. The pull start can come off either the 3 or 4 wheeler. As far as warm it up, they are a little cold blooded, but check your air hoses for cracks or leaks, it will lean it out and cause it to jump around at idle.
